利用Matlab直观感受不等量异种电荷电场和电势
2021-03-25胡科杰吴志刚戎杰
胡科杰 吴志刚 戎杰
(浙江省慈溪中学 浙江 宁波 315300)
1 问题的提出
高中物理中有如下两个试题:
【例1】图1为两个不等量异种电荷电场的电场线,O点为两点电荷连线的中点,P点为连线中垂线上的一点,下列判断正确的是( )
图1 例1题图
A.P点场强大于O点场强
B.P点电势高于O点电势
C.从负电荷向右到无限远电势逐渐升高
D.从P到O移动一正试探电荷其电势能增加
【例2】如图2所示,两个电荷量分别为q1和q2的点电荷放在x轴上的O和M两点,两点电荷连线上各点电势φ随x变化的关系如图2所示,其中P和N两点的电势为零,NF段中Q点电势最高,下列判断正确的是( )
图2 例2题图
A.q1和q2为等量异种电荷,且Q点电场强度为零
B.q1和q2为不等量种异种电荷,且P点电场强度为零
C.NQ间场强方向沿x轴正方向
D.将一负电荷从N点移到F点,电势能先减小后增大
两个例题分别考察了不等量异种电荷的电场线分布和电势变化情况[1~3].等量同种或异种电荷的电场线和等势面是高中物理学习的重点和难点,由于电场的不可见性,该知识已经非常抽象难懂,学生学习理解存在着较大困难[4].在实际教学中,往往采用等高线来模拟,用山峰表示正电荷形成的电势,用海谷表示负电荷形成的电势,如图3所示.
图3 等量异种电荷和等量同种电荷的电场线及等势面
对于不等量的异种电荷,电场较难确定,特别在边界和临界问题上,更加无法明确[5,6].本文通过Matlab软件,模拟不等量异种电荷的电场线和等势面,使原本抽象难懂的电场线和等势面变得直观形象.
2 使用Matlab绘图不等量异种电荷的电势情况
如图4所示,两个不等量异种电荷Q1和Q2分别位于坐标(0,0)和(1,0)
图4 两个不等量异种电荷
为方便讨论,取Q1=4,Q2=-1,kQ=1.
可进行如下编程:
x=-5:0.1:5;
y=-5:0.1:5;
[X,Y]=meshgrid(x,y);
z3=z1+z2;
surf(X,Y,z3)
运行结果立体图如图5所示,可以看出,正电荷如一山峰,负电荷如一海谷,山峰高度大于海谷深度.
(说明:图5及以下各图中的数值均为无量纲化表示)
图5 立体图
主视图如图6所示.
图6 主视图
等势面如图7所示.
图7 等势面图
电场线如图8所示.
图8 电场线图
放大局部如图9所示.
图9 电场线的局部放大图
x轴电势变化如图10所示.
图10 x轴电势变化图
放大局部如图11所示,分析可知,在Q2右侧,电势从负变正,再逐渐趋向于零,与例2中图相对应,只是例2中图像更加凸显.
图11 x轴电势的局部放大图
3 小结
通过利用Matlab软件绘图,使我们更加清晰地了解了不等量异种电荷的电场线和电势分布,也深刻体会到信息技术在物理研究中的作用,提升了学习和教学品质.